@$56019: Ethereum Drops below $500 Billion Market Cap Level
Ethereum has lost nearly 15% of its value in the last 7 days after touching an all-time high of almost $4,900. While the price of ETH stayed above $4,000, its market cap has dropped from the $500 billion level.
However, Ethereum’s fundamental indicators remained strong in the last few days. The total number of daily active ETH addresses currently stands at around 650,000. Though, ‘Buy the Dip’ calls dominated the market sentiment during the recent correction.
The rising transaction fee is still a major issue with Ethereum. The ETH community is hopeful about a solution after its network upgrade, but current data suggests that users have struggled due to an enormous rise in fees during the market drop this week.
